Facts about Page St.

When was Page St. released?


Page St. is first released on June 06, 2005 as part of Stephen Covell's album "Perfect Parade" which includes 14 tracks in total. This song is the 2nd track on this album.

Which genre is Page St.?


Page St. falls under the genre Pop.
